Understanding the Importance of an EIN

Starting a business is an exciting venture, but it also comes with its own set of responsibilities, one of which is obtaining an Employer Identification Number (EIN). An EIN is a unique nine-digit number assigned by the IRS to identify your business entity for tax purposes. Whether you’re operating a sole proprietorship, partnership, or corporation, having an EIN is essential for hiring employees, opening a business bank account, and filing tax returns.

Essential Criteria for Applying for an EIN

Before you begin the process of securing an EIN, it’s important to understand the qualifications required. Generally, you need to meet the following criteria:

  • Your business must be located in the United States or its territories.
  • You must be the owner or authorized representative of the business.
  • Your business structure can be a sole proprietorship, partnership, corporation, or LLC.

Steps to Secure Your EIN

The application process for an EIN is straightforward.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ate through it:

  1. Determine Your Eligibility: Make sure you meet the requirements mentioned above.
  2. Gather Necessary Information: You’ll need details such as your business name, structure, and address.
  3. Complete the Application: You can apply online through the IRS website, via mail, or by fax. The online method is the fastest.
  4. Review Your Application: Ensure all information is accurate to avoid any delays.
  5. Submit Your Application: After reviewing, submit your application and wait for the EIN issuance.

Avoiding Common Pitfalls

While applying for an EIN may seem simple, there are common mistakes that applicants might make:

  • Submitting an application with incorrect or incomplete information.
  • Failing to apply online, which can delay the process.
  • Not keeping a record of your EIN once it’s issued.

By avoiding these errors, you can streamline the process and ensure a smoother experience.

If you apply online, you will typically receive your EIN immediately upon completing your application. Applications submitted by mail or fax may take longer, often several weeks.
